  • Patent number: 10001701
    Abstract: A structure including an EUV mask and a pellicle attached to the EUV mask. The pellicle includes a pellicle frame and a plurality of pellicle membrane layers attached to the pellicle frame. The plurality of pellicle membrane layers include at least one core pellicle membrane layer and an additional pellicle membrane layer is disposed on the at least one core pellicle membrane layer. In some embodiments, the additional pellicle membrane layer is a material having a thermal emissivity greater than 0.2, a transmittance greater than 80%, and a refractive index (n) for 13.5 nanometer source of greater than 0.9.

  • Patent number: 9996013
    Abstract: An extreme ultraviolet lithography (EUVL) system is disclosed. The system includes an extreme ultraviolet (EUV) mask with three states having respective reflection coefficient is r1, r2 and r3, wherein r3 is a pre-specified value that is a function of r1 and r2. The system also includes a nearly on-axis illumination (ONI) with partial coherence ? less than 0.3 to expose the EUV mask to produce diffracted light and non-diffracted light. The system further includes a projection optics box (PUB) to remove a portion of the non-diffracted light and to collect and direct the diffracted light and the remaining non-diffracted light to expose a target.

  • Patent number: 9869939
    Abstract: A method for being used in a lithography process is provided. The method includes receiving a first mask, a second mask and a substrate with a set of baseline registration marks. A first set of registration marks is formed on the substrate using the first mask and a first exposure tool, and a first set of overlay errors is determined. The first set of registration marks is removed and a second set of registration marks is formed on the substrate using the second mask and a second exposure tool. A second set of overlay errors is determined. A set of tool-induced overlay errors is generated from the first and second sets of overlay errors and used in fabricating a third mask. The third mask can then be used in the lithography process to accommodate the overlay errors caused by different exposure tools, different masks, and different mask writers.

  • Patent number: 9870612
    Abstract: A method includes inspecting a mask to locate a defect region for a defect of the mask. A phase distribution of an aerial image of the defect region is acquired. A point spread function of an imaging system is determined. One or more repair regions of the mask are identified based on the phase distribution of the aerial image of the defect region and the point spread function. A repair process is performed to the one or more repair regions of the mask to form one or more repair features.

  • Patent number: 9823585
    Abstract: Systems and methods for monitoring the focus of an EUV lithography system are disclosed. Another aspect includes a method having operations of measuring a first shift value for a first patterned set of sub-structures of a focus test structure on a wafer and measuring a second shift value for a second patterned set of sub-structures of the test structure on the wafer. The test structure may be formed on the wafer using asymmetric illumination, with the first patterned set of sub-structures having a first pitch and the second patterned set of sub-structures having a second pitch that is different from the first pitch. The method may further include determining a focus shift compensation for an illumination system based on a difference between the first shift value and the second shift value.

  • Publication number: 20170277040
    Abstract: Lithography methods and corresponding lithography apparatuses are disclosed herein for improving throughput of lithography exposure processes. An exemplary lithography method includes generating a plurality of target material droplets and generating radiation from the plurality of target material droplets based on a dose margin to expose a wafer. The dose margin indicates how many of the plurality of target material droplets are reserved for dose control. In some implementations, the plurality of target material droplets are grouped into a plurality of bursts, and the lithography method further includes performing an inter-compensation operation that designates an excitation state of target material droplets in one of the plurality of bursts to compensate for an energy characteristic of another one of the plurality of bursts.
